Taka Corp Studio Exodia Necross Bust Preorders Now Open

Exodia Necross fans — your day has come at last. Today, Taka Corp Studio began accepting preorders for its Exodia Necross bust. The French collectibles company produced only 50 copies of this resin statue, making it one of the rarest Yu-Gi-Oh! collectibles in the world. And with a price tag of €899 (about $1,062), it’s also one of the most expensive.

Exodia Necross is a variant of Taka Corp’s original Exodia the Forbidden One bust, differing only in color. It measures H60 x W70 x D45 centimeters (about H24 x W28 x D18 inches) and weighs 15 kilograms (about 33 pounds).

The original Exodia bust, which has an edition size of 150, is still available for purchase for €899 (about $1,062).

Taka Corp is offering worldwide shipping for Exodia and Exodia Necross. Shipping one statue to the U.S. or Canada costs €70 (about $84). To all other countries outside the European Union, it is €99 (about $118).
